North Pole Calling

Pelham Parks and Recreation is happy to once again offer the free North Pole Calling program for children in preschool through grades 2 or 3.  The grades are simply a guideline; any child who would appreciate a call can be included if the parent completes a form.  One form per child please.  On Sunday, December 14, 2008 from 5-7 pm, Santa, Mrs. Claus and their North Pole helpers will make calls to local children about their Christmas wishes.  You must be home to receive the call as that is the only time they will be made.  Deadline for complete form is Dec. 12th.  This program is great fun for a seasonal activity appreciated by all involved.  Helpers are needed!  Kindly email or call us at (603) 635-2721 if you can assist.  Thank you!

Men's Pick-up

Basketball

 

NOTE: Program will Start 9/18

Pelham Parks and Recreation is accepting registrations once again for the popular Men's Pick Up Basketball program (must be at least 18 yrs. of age and graduated from high school). Games start Thursday, September 18, 2008 at 8:00 p.m. in the Pelham Elementary school gym and continue each Tuesday and Thursday through the school year. Program is subject to school needs, holiday/vacation cancellations or closures for inclement weather. The cost is $35/player and open to Pelham residents only.

Our supervisor is Bob Charette.  Please check in with him at the court.

* Indoor Soccer - Parks and Recreation offers a 6 week indoor soccer program for boys and girls ages 5-12.  Look for registration to open up in February.

* Parent/Tot Playgroup -  This is a free program which meets Tuesdays, 10:00 am - noon at Raymond Park Scout Lodge beginning October 21, 2008. Open to parents or guardians with infant children to age 5.  Click on Tot Programs link located in the left menu for more information.

* Hip Hop Dance Classes - there seems to be plenty of interest in the class.  We are trying to find a place to host it.  Stay tuned for details. 

* Lacrosse- Parks and Rec would like to start a lacrosse program in the spring.  We have joined USA Lacrosse and filed for a grant that would supply all the equipment for 1 boy's team and 1 girl's team.  We would like to enter teams starting at the middle school level and build the program from there.  Coaches would be needed.  Please email Brian if interested recreation@pelhamweb.com
